Ahead of launch in India, KTM 250 Adventure's bookings open
-
KTM is planning to launch its 250 Adventure motorcycle in India next week.
In the latest development, the company's dealerships have started accepting bookings for the two-wheeler for a refundable token amount between Rs. 1,000-5,000.
As for the highlights, the 250 Adventure will come in two color options and draw power from a BS6-compliant 248cc engine.

Design
KTM 250 Adventure: At a glance
-
The KTM 250 Adventure will be built on a steel trellis frame and borrow styling cues from the 390 Adventure. It will feature a sloping fuel tank, a stepped-up seat, an upswept exhaust pipe, and eye-catching body graphics.
The bike will pack a halogen headlight with LED DRLs and a Bluetooth-enabled TFT instrument panel. It will ride on blacked-out designer alloy wheels.

Power and performance
-
The KTM 250 Adventure will draw power from a BS6-compliant 248cc, single-cylinder, liquid-cooled engine that makes 30hp of maximum power and 25Nm of peak torque. The motor will come mated to a 6-speed manual gearbox.

Safety
What about safety and suspension setup?
-
To ensure the safety of the rider, the KTM 250 Adventure will be equipped with disc brakes on both the front and rear wheels along with dual-channel ABS to avoid skidding on the road while braking.
Meanwhile, the suspension duties on the premium motorcycle will be handled by long-travel USD forks on the front side and a mono-shock unit on the rear end.

How much will it cost?
-
Details related to the availability and pricing of the KTM 250 Adventure in India will be announced at the time of launch. However, the adventure tourer is likely to carry a price-tag of around Rs. 2.40-2.50 lakh, and take on the Royal Enfield Himalayan.
